#!/usr/bin/perl
# @hourly /usr/local/bin/sa-stats.pl --web --n=25 > /var/www/html/spamstat/index.html
# -------------------------------------------------------------
# file: sa-stats.pl (SARE release)
# created: 2005-01-31
# updated: 2007-01-30
# version: 1.03
# author: Dallas <dallase@uribl.com>
# desc: Generates Top Spam/Ham Rules fired for SA 3.1.x installations.
#
# IMPORTANT NOTES
#
# SA 3.0.x log files do not have user=<user> in
# the report: log entries, so this does not work with 3.0.
# See http://www.rulesemporium.com/programs/sa-stats.txt for
# a SA 3.0.x version ( no per-domain / per-user support )
#
# If your top 5 does not contain URIBL_BLACK, see
# http://www.uribl.com/usage.shtml
# -------------------------------------------------------------
# Per User and Per Domain Statistics...
# -------------------------------------------------------------
#
# ./sa-stats -r postmaster
# - this would give all stats for postmaster users,
# regardless of which domain it was for. handy if you
# have alot of domain aliases
#
# ./sa-stats -r @domain
# - this would give all stats for the domain specified.
# make sure you include the '@' sign before the
# domain or the script will assume you wanted a user
# name instead.
#
# ./sa-stats -r user@domain.com
# - this would give all stats for a specific email address.
# this assumes you pass 'spamc -u <fullemail>' vs.
# 'spamc -u <userpart>'. If you do the latter, you simply
# want to call -r <userpart> instead.
#

use Getopt::Long;
use Pod::Usage;
my ($LOG_DIR,$FILE,$TOPRULES,$PRINT_TO_WEB,$HELP,$RECIP);
GetOptions (
'logdir|l=s' => \$LOG_DIR,
'filename|f=s' => \$FILE,
'recip|r=s' => \$RECIP,
'num|n=i' => \$TOPRULES,
'web|w' => \$PRINT_TO_WEB,
'help|h' => \$HELP
);
if ($HELP) {
print "usage: $0 [-l <dir>] [-f <file>] [-n <num>] [-w]\n";
print "\t--logdir|-l <dir>\tDirectory containing spamd logs\n";
print "\t--filename|-f <file>\tFile names or regex to look for in the logdir\n";
print "\t--num|-n <num>\tNumber of top rules to display\n";
print "\t--web|-w\tMake it web friendly output\n";
print "\t--help|-h\tPrints this help\n";
exit;
}
if (!defined $TOPRULES) { $TOPRULES=20 }
if (!defined $LOG_DIR) { $LOG_DIR="/var/log" }
if (!defined $FILE) { $FILE='^maillog$' } # regex
# LEAVE THE REST ALONE UNLESS YOU KNOW WHAT YOU ARE DOING...
################################################################
my $NUM_EMAIL=0; my $NUM_SPAM=0; my $NUM_HAM=0;
my $EMAIL_HITS=0; my $SPAM_HITS=0; my $HAM_HITS=0;
my %SPAM_RULES=(); my %HAM_RULES=();
my $TOTAL_SPAM_RULES=0; my $TOTAL_HAM_RULES=0;
my $ALSPAM=0; my $ALHAM=0; my $ALNO=0;
my $HAM_SEC=0; my $SPAM_SEC=0; my $EMAIL_SEC=0;
my $footer = '</div><div id="footer"><p> CGI by Dallas Engelken </p></div>';
opendir (DIR,"$LOG_DIR");
my @logs = grep /$FILE/i, readdir DIR;
closedir DIR;
foreach my $log (@logs) {
&calcstats($LOG_DIR."/".$log);
}
&summarize();
exit;

sub calcstats {
my $log=shift;
if (!-e $log || -d $log) {
print "$log not found..\n";
return;
}
open(F,"$log");
while(<F>) {
my ($result,$score,$rules,$time,$size,$learn,$recip);
my $spam=0;
# for user=, it may be %domain or $GLOBAL or @GLOBAL or user@domain..
if (/.*result:\s+(\w|\.)\s+(\-?\d+)\s+\-\s+(.*)\s+scantime\=([\d\.]+)\,size\=(\d+).*user=([^\,]+).*autolearn=(\w+)/) {
$result=$1;
$score=$2;
$rules=$3;
$time=$4;
$size=$5;
$recip=$6;
$learn=$7;
}
else {
next;
}
my ($user,$domain);
if ($recip =~ m/^[\%\@](.+)/) {
$user = undef;
$domain = '@'.$1;
}
if ($recip =~ m/(.+)\@(.+)/) {
$user=$1;
$domain='@'.$2;
}
else {
$user=$recip;
$domain='@localhost';
}
my $email = $user.$domain;
next if ($RECIP && $RECIP !~ m/\@/ && $RECIP ne $user);
next if ($RECIP =~ m/^[\%\@](.+)/ && $RECIP ne $domain);
next if ($RECIP =~ m/(.+)\@(.+)/ && $RECIP ne $email);
if ($result eq "Y") {
$SPAM_SEC+=$time;
}
else {
$HAM_SEC+=$time;
}
$EMAIL_SEC+=$time;
$spam=1 if ($result =~ m/Y/);
if ($learn =~ /ham/) {
$ALHAM++;
}
elsif ($learn =~ /spam/) {
$ALSPAM++;
}
else {
$ALNO++;
}
my @tmprules=split(/\,/,$rules);
foreach my $r (@tmprules) {
if ($spam) {
$TOTAL_SPAM_RULES++;
if (defined $SPAM_RULES{$r}) {
$SPAM_RULES{$r}++;
}
else {
$SPAM_RULES{$r}=1;
}
}
else {
$TOTAL_HAM_RULES++;
if (defined $HAM_RULES{$r}) {
$HAM_RULES{$r}++;
}
else {
$HAM_RULES{$r}=1;
}
}
}
if ($spam) {
$NUM_SPAM++;
$SPAM_HITS += $score;
}
else {
$NUM_HAM++;
$HAM_HITS += $score;
}
$NUM_EMAIL++;
$EMAIL_HITS += $score;
}
close(F);
}
